Samuel L. Jackson Biography: Born on 12/21/1948 in Washington D.C. He gained respect as a talented actor, and for his performance in the movie "Jungle Fever" Jackson won a Cannes Film Festival Supporting Actor Award. His breakout role, though, was in the hit movie "Pulp Fiction" and since then he has starred in "Die Hard With a Vengeance", "The Negotiator", "A Time to Kill", "Deep Blue Sea", and, most recently, "Shaft".
